Surgical Purpose and Applications
Rib spreaders are essential instruments in thoracotomy procedures, allowing surgeons to gain controlled access to the thoracic cavity by gradually separating the ribs. The Fino Rib Spreader is commonly utilized in general thoracic surgery, pulmonary resection, cardiothoracic procedures, and other interventions requiring stable intercostal access. Its medium 65x45mm spread specification makes it well-suited for standard adult patients, offering an appropriate balance between adequate surgical exposure and controlled, safe rib separation.
Design Features
This instrument features a reliable ratchet mechanism that allows for gradual, incremental spreading of the rib cage while maintaining consistent tension throughout the procedure. The 65x45mm spread range is calibrated to provide sufficient thoracic access for most standard adult procedures without risking excessive strain on the rib cage. The blades are contoured to minimize tissue trauma and reduce the risk of rib fracture during extended retraction.
The 8″ frame size offers surgeons a practical balance of reach and control, allowing the instrument to be positioned securely within the surgical field. The smooth ratchet action allows surgeons to lock the spreader at the desired aperture, freeing both hands for further surgical work while maintaining stable exposure throughout the procedure.

FAQs
1. What is the Fino Rib Spreader used for?
It is used to separate the ribs during thoracotomy procedures, providing surgeons with controlled access to the thoracic cavity.
2. What does the 65x45mm spread specification mean?
This measurement indicates the maximum spread range the instrument can achieve, calibrated to provide adequate exposure for standard adult thoracic procedures.
3. Is this instrument suitable for pediatric patients?
No. This medium-sized, 65x45mm spread version is calibrated for adult patients. A pediatric-specific rib spreader should be used for children.
